    Are all rooms at AKL Jambo House being refurbished? I'm planning on staying in Fall 2020 and wondered if I'd still need to request a refurbished room or if they will all be done by then.

    Jambo Charlene!

    Welcome to the Disney Parks Moms Panel. You are looking at one of my favorite Disney Vacation Club Resorts! My favorite part of the Resort is the animal Cast Members, but I also love the feeling of being away from everything while being smack in the middle of the Magic. The Resort is the perfect place to rest, relax, and recharge.

    Walt Disney World is always looking for ways to improve it's Guests' experience, and one of those ways is through updating the Resorts. We stayed at Disney's Animal Kingdom Villas - Kidani Village in November, and the Resort was in full reno mode! Our Villa was gorgeous and newly renovated, and most of the construction work was happening outside. In spite of the busyness, the refurbishment never interfered with our magical vacation. Currently, Jambo House's renovation is slated to finish by the end of the yEAR in 2020, but that could change depending on The Mouse!
